Laravel Vapor-在公共开发数据库上创建用户失败,错误为:需要jumpbox

Laravel Vapor-在公共开发数据库上创建用户失败,错误为:需要jumpbox,laravel,amazon-web-services,amazon-rds,serverless,laravel-vapor,Laravel,Amazon Web Services,Amazon Rds,Serverless,Laravel Vapor,Laravel Vapor数据库文档说明: 要快速创建性能级别最小的公共可访问数据库,您可以在创建数据库时使用--dev标志。这些小型、价格合理的数据库非常适合于测试或登台环境 我已经使用建议的vapor数据库dev db--dev命令创建了一个dev数据库,并且在AWS中创建了一个publicdb.t3.micro,但是当我使用vapor数据库:user dev db user1命令向数据库添加其他用户时,我收到一个错误,即需要一个跳线盒: 哎呀!你的请求有一些问题 创建数据库用户需要一个跳

Laravel Vapor数据库文档说明:

要快速创建性能级别最小的公共可访问数据库,您可以在创建数据库时使用
--dev
标志。这些小型、价格合理的数据库非常适合于测试或登台环境

我已经使用建议的
vapor数据库dev db--dev
命令创建了一个dev数据库,并且在AWS中创建了一个public
db.t3.micro
,但是当我使用
vapor数据库:user dev db user1
命令向数据库添加其他用户时,我收到一个错误,即需要一个跳线盒:

哎呀!你的请求有一些问题

  • 创建数据库用户需要一个跳线盒
有关私有/公共数据库的文档说明:

此外,这些数据库可以公开访问(使用Vapor自动分配的长随机密码)或私有。私人数据库通常不能从公共互联网访问。要从本地计算机访问它们,您需要创建一个Vapor jumpbox


既然
--dev
数据库创建命令创建了一个可公开访问的数据库,为什么会返回一个错误,指出需要一个跳线盒?

这听起来像是一个错误,除非您在数据库完成配置之前尝试创建用户

可能是一个错误;是,在尝试创建用户时,数据库已经在AWS中完成了配置